Redis让读写更快,应用更灵活(redis读写时间)
Redis是一种开源,用于存储大量数据,它可以让读写变得更快,应用更灵活。它是一种非关系数据库,用于在集群、云服务及分布式系统中高效地存储和存取数据。
Redis能够极大地提高读写速度。它使用内存而不是磁盘作为存储介质,因此可以说,Redis的存储ISE比磁盘存储要快得多,读取也比磁盘要快得多。比如,一个操作在磁盘中可能需要几秒的时间,而在Redis中可以在几毫秒内完成。这就使得Redis成为了高性能应用的理想之选,比如网站后台、排行榜功能等等。
Redis还使得应用变得更加灵活。Redis支持多种数据类型,包括字符串,散列,列表,集合,有序集合和 Hyperloglog。因此,可以使用多种数据类型来存储和の入数据,并能够以不同的方式快速检索数据,而不需要额外的开发工作。此外,Redis还支持数据持久化,可以轻松实现日志或者状态的持久化。
Redis还提供了诸多强大的功能。它可以方便地支持缓存,从而极大地减少对后端数据存储的访问,极大提高响应速度。此外,Redis也支持数据分片,可以在一个集群,多个实例,多个集群,云服务和分布式系统中实现。
因此,Redis在高性能应用中大受欢迎,它不仅支持高性能读写,而且支持灵活的数据存储,支持多种丰富的功能,使得Redis成为了高性能应用的理想之选 开发者和用户的.
以下是一段关于使用Redis的相关代码:
// 创建Redis客户端
var Redis = require('redis');var redisClient = Redis.createClient();
// 设置一个键值对redisClient.set('name', 'Jack', function(err, res){
if (err) { console.log(err);
} else { console.log(res);
}});
// 获取值redisClient.get('name', function(err, res){
if (err) { console.log(err);
} else { console.log(res);
}});
Redis使得读写变得更快,应用变得更灵活,可以大大提高性能,是使用现有保险应用的理想之选。